Core Principles of Data Structures and Algorithms in Informatika

Data structures and algorithms are the foundation of computer science. In informatika, a dedicated field of study centered around information processing, understanding these concepts is crucial. Data structures organize data in efficient formats, while algorithms offer step-by-step instructions for performing specific tasks. A skilled informatikian must demonstrate a deep knowledge of various data structures, such as arrays, linked lists, stacks, queues, and trees, along with their respective implementations.

  • Additionally, algorithms contribute in optimizing the performance of programs by reducing time and space complexity.
  • Illustrations of algorithms include sorting, searching, graph traversal, and pathfinding.
  • Acquiring these concepts allows informatikian to design efficient and scalable solutions for a diverse range of problems.

Securing Information Technology Infrastructures

In today's interconnected world, digital threats pose a significant risk to individuals, organizations, and governments. To mitigate these risks, robust cybersecurity measures are critical. A comprehensive strategy should encompass various layers of protection, including network defenses, intrusion prevention systems, secure communication methods, and employee education programs.

It is important to implement strong authentication mechanisms to prevent unauthorized access to sensitive data. Regular vulnerability assessments and security audits can help identify potential gaps in the system.

Furthermore, staying aware about the latest risks and implementing updates promptly is crucial to maintaining a secure environment.
